What Are French Entry Doors?

French entry doors are normally double doors with big glass panels that enable natural light into the home while providing an unobstructed view of the outside. Understood for their beauty, these doors often open external to a patio or garden, making them a best choice for homes that worth an indoor-outdoor way of life.

Picking the Right French Entry Doors

When picking the perfect French entry doors, several factors need to be taken into account.

1. Product

French doors can be found in various materials, each offering unique benefits.

ProductBenefitsDownsides
WoodClassic beauty, excellent insulationNeeds routine upkeep
FiberglassResilient, energy-efficient, low upkeepCan be more expensive than wood
AluminumLightweight, modern appearance, low upkeepLess insulation compared to wood or fiberglass
SteelHigh security, resilienceCan rust if not properly completed

2. Design

French doors are available in a variety of styles, consisting of:

  • Traditional: Classic design with detailed information.
  • Contemporary: Sleek, modern appearance with minimalistic features.
  • Personalized: Tailored to fit specific design preferences.

3. Glass Options

The type of glass you choose can considerably impact visual appeals and energy effectiveness. Options consist of:

  • Tempered Glass: Stronger and safer, resistant to thermal tension.
  • Frosted Glass: Offers privacy while still permitting light.
  • Ornamental Glass: Comes in different patterns that enhance visual interest.

Upkeep and Care

While French entry doors are stunning, they do require regular upkeep to keep them looking their best. Here are some tips:

  1. Regular Cleaning: Clean the glass and frames frequently to prevent dirt and gunk buildup.
  2. Inspect Seals and Weatherstripping: Check for any wear and tear. Change seals as required to keep energy efficiency.
  3. Refinish Wood: If you have wooden doors, regular refinishing will safeguard them from the aspects.
  4. Examine Hardware: Periodically inspect hinges, manages, and locks for proper function and lubrication.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Are French entry doors energy efficient?

Yes, modern French doors come with energy-efficient glass options and insulation functions that assist maintain a comfortable indoor temperature level.

2. Do French doors supply adequate security?

While French doors can be safe and secure, it's vital to choose top quality locks and think about setting up extra security functions to boost safety.

3. Can I install French doors myself?

Basic installations may be workable for DIY enthusiasts, but for best outcomes-- especially with heavy or custom doors-- it is recommended to employ a professional.

4. What are the typical costs of French entry doors?

Expenses can vary widely based upon products, design, and installation. Usually, house owners might invest anywhere from 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 5,000 or more.

5. For how long do French entry doors last?

With correct care, premium French doors can last anywhere from 20 to 50 years, depending upon the products used and local environmental conditions.
